Avatar, Terminator, Stan Winston and what he’s been doing for the last 12 years

Avatar, Terminator, Stan Winston and what he’s been doing for the last 12 years.In a great guest blog, Scyfi Love’s man in London Craig Grobler – aka @ckc1ne on Twitter and a top bloke all around – tells of meeting up and spending three hours in the company of James Cameron ahead of the release of his latest blockbuster, Avatar. In that time Cameron and Craig talked about the origins of his most famous creation, The Terminator, his hopes for Avatar and the technology behind it, the death of Stan Winston and what the future may hold.

Soak up the special atmosphere that makes a film at the Philharmonic unique. If you’ve never been to a film in the beautiful art deco surroundings of Philharmonic Hall then you’re in for a treat... The Hall houses the only working Walturdaw Cinema screen in the world, rising from the stage accompanied by resident organist Dave Nicholas, an institution in his own right.
